Deeping

/ˈdiːpɪŋ/ noun

Definition

The action or process of making something deeper, or a place that becomes deeper.

Etymology

From 'deep' (verb form, meaning to make deep) + '-ing' suffix. The verb 'deep' is archaic but appears in Middle English texts referring to digging or excavation.

Kelly Says

Medieval ditch-diggers and dredgers used this term to describe their work—the 'deeping' of rivers and moats made them more effective barriers and waterways.
